How they compare

Mauritania currently reports 11.3% against 10.0% in Tanzania, United Republic of, a difference of 1.3%.

That makes Mauritania's figure about 1.1 times Tanzania, United Republic of's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Tanzania, United Republic of ahead.

Mauritania ranks 16th and Tanzania, United Republic of ranks 19th of 141 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Mauritania averaged higher in 2 and Tanzania, United Republic of in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Mauritania Tanzania, United Republic of Difference Ahead
1990s 12.4% 14.2% 1.8% Tanzania, United Republic of
2000s 14.0% 10.5% 3.6% Mauritania
2010s 11.6% 6.6% 5.0% Mauritania

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Interest rate spread is the interest rate charged by banks on loans to private sector customers minus the interest rate paid by commercial or similar banks for demand, time, or savings deposits. The terms and conditions attached to these rates differ by country, however, limiting their comparability.
